The amendments to the Judiciary Act will be rediscussed by MPs during the Legal Committee. These are the texts challenged by a veto by President Rumen Radev.
In them, MPs wrote that within 6 months they must elect an entirely new composition of the Supreme Judicial Council, whose mandate expired last October.
The amendments also provide for the creation of a special system for random selection of the judge, who will investigate the Prosecutor General and his deputies. One of Radev's motives for the veto was that this law does not contribute to an effective reform of the justice system.
This week, MPs will also vote on a draft decision to provide additional military assistance to Ukraine.
Defense Committee approves sending missiles to Ukraine
It is planned to send additional military assistance to Ukraine, which consists of cartridges and anti-aircraft guided missiles for the S-300.
